Why is my roof's ridge cap a common problem for Rochester homes?
The ridge cap is the highest point of your roof, taking the brunt of our strong Lake Ontario winds and heavy snow loads. Over time, this constant exposure can crack the shingles, loosen the fasteners, and compromise the sealant, leading to leaks and drafts. Our repair process involves a thorough inspection, removal of damaged materials, and a resecured installation with premium, weather-resistant sealants to restore a tight seal against Rochester's elements.
What causes roof valley leaks in our area, and how do you fix them?
Roof valleys are critical drainage channels. In Rochester, they are frequently clogged by fall leaves and pine needles, then backed up by ice dams in winter. This standing water and ice eventually penetrate under the shingles. Our fix starts with clearing all debris. We then inspect the underlying flashing—the metal channel that guides water—for rust, cracks, or improper installation. We repair or replace this flashing with heavy-gauge, corrosion-resistant material and re-shingle the valley with a water-tight weave method to ensure proper drainage during our heavy rains and snow melts.
As a local roofer, what materials do you recommend for our climate?
We recommend materials specifically suited for Rochester's freeze-thaw cycles and precipitation. For asphalt shingles, we use impact-resistant and algae-resistant varieties with strong warranties. For metal roofing, we install standing seam panels that efficiently shed snow and resist corrosion. Proper underlayment is also crucial; we use ice and water shield in critical areas like valleys and eaves to prevent ice dam damage. Our goal is to install a system that not only looks great but is built to last through our demanding local weather.
